Dr. Frydman serves as a full-time Associate Professor of Clinical Dentistry in the Division of Restorative Sciences at the Herman Ostrow School of Dentistry of USC and also in the Division of Periodontology. Our esteemed doctor is dedicated to training residents to become experienced surgeons and helping dental students become periodontal specialists.
After completing his undergraduate work at UCLA, Dr. Frydman completed a specialty residency at the Advanced Periodontology Program at USC and has continued to be a valued member of the university’s faculty. He teaches continuing education courses in implant therapy as well as treatment planning. Additionally, he delivers national lectures that discuss implant disease and aggressive periodontitis.
Dr. Frydman is a proud diplomate as an Examiner for the American Board of Periodontology and the American Board of Periodontology. His publications and research focus on immunocompromised populations, periodontal disease, as well as implant therapy.
